    Going Beyond Counting First Authors in Author Co-citation Analysis

    Get PDF
    The present study examines one of the fundamental aspects of author co-citation analysis (ACA) - the way co-citation counts are defined. Co-citation counting provides the data on which all subsequent statistical analyses and mappings are based, and we compare ACA results based on two different types of co-citation counting - the traditional type that only counts the first one among a cited work's authors on the one hand and a non-traditional type that takes into account the first 5 authors of a cited work on the other hand. Results indicate that the picture produced through this non-traditional author co-citation counting contains more coherent author groups and is therefore considerably clearer. However, this picture represents fewer specialties in the research field being studied than that produced through the traditional first-author co-citation counting when the same number of top-ranked authors is selected and analyzed. Reasons for these effects are discussed

    Variations on the Author

    Get PDF
    “Variations on the Author” discusses two of Eduardo Coutinho’s recent films (Um Dia na Vida, from 2010, and Últimas Conversas, posthumously released in 2015) and their contribution to the general question of documentary authorship. The director’s filmography is characterized by a consistent yet self-effacing form of authorial self-inscription: Coutinho often features as an interviewer that rather than express opinions propels discourses; an interviewer that is good at listening. This mode of self-inscription characterizes him as an author who is not expressive but who is nonetheless markedly present on the screen. In Um Dia na Vida, however, Coutinho is completely absent form the image, while Últimas Conversas, on the contrary, includes a confessional prologue that moves the director from the margins to the center of his films. This article examines the ways in which these works stand out in the filmography of a director who offers new insights into the notion of cinematic authorship

    Effects of Biochar Amendment on Soil Problems and Improving Rice Production under Salinity Conditions

    Get PDF
    Soil with poor physio-chemical and biological properties prevent plant growth. These poor characteristics may be due to soil creation processes, but also include largely inappropriate agricultural practices and/or anthropogenic pollution. During the last 4 decades, the world has lost one-third of its cropland due to pollution and erosion. Therefore, a series of operations is required to improve and recover the soil. Biochar is a new multifunctional carbon material extensively used as a modifier to improve soil quality and crop production. Previous studies have discussed the properties of biochar with varying soil pollutants and their effects on soil productivity and carbon sequestration. Comparatively, little attention has been paid to the effects of biochar application on rice growth in the problem of soils, especially in the saline-sodic soils. A comprehensive review of the literature with a high focusing on the effects of biochar application on problem soils and rice-growing under salinity conditions is needed. The present review gives an overview of the soil's problem, biochar amendment effects on physicochemical properties of soil, and how the biochar amendment could interact in soil microbes and root with remediation under salinity conditions for improving rice productivity. The findings of this review showed that biochar application can improve soil quality, reduce soil's problem and increase rice production under salinity conditions. It is anticipated that further researches on the biochar amendment will increase our understanding of the interactions of biochar with soil components, accelerate our attempts on soil remediation, and improve rice production under salinity conditions

    Appropriate Similarity Measures for Author Cocitation Analysis

    Get PDF
    We provide a number of new insights into the methodological discussion about author cocitation analysis. We first argue that the use of the Pearson correlation for measuring the similarity between authors’ cocitation profiles is not very satisfactory. We then discuss what kind of similarity measures may be used as an alternative to the Pearson correlation. We consider three similarity measures in particular. One is the well-known cosine. The other two similarity measures have not been used before in the bibliometric literature.     Evaluation of the Main Risk Factors Impact on Mortality Rate of Turkish Lambs in the Kunduz Province of Afghanistan

    No full text
    Aims: The objective of this study was to find out the lamb\u27s mortality rate of associated risk factors in Kunduz province that identify mortality problems, survival lambs, and risk factors in Turkish lambs. Design of Study: Using survey methods sampling by distributing questionnaires to sheep farmers. Place and Duration of Study: A total of 12 villages in two main districts (Imam Sahib and Ali Abad) of Kunduz province were observed from March to December 2020. Methodology: All the 72 sheep farmers were selected that they had 500 -1000 Turkish sheep on average (lambs were 56% males and 44% females), and main risk associated factors impact the mortality rate of lambs based on means performed by One sample and Paired T-Test were determined. Results: The results of the study indicate that the mortality rate of the lambs was observed at 21.696% (in Kunduz province), while the mortality rate of lambs was no significant difference in the mortality percentage of two districts with P-Value = 0.462, as in Imam Sahib district, the mortality rate of lambs was 20.995%, and Aliabad reported 22.34%, individually. The analyses of variance showed that the main risk factors impact in the district of Imam Sahib was observed highly significant differences in overall variables except for dystocia in comparison to the Aliabad district. The impact of risk factors on mortality rate of lambs in Kunduz province were recorded greater by 3.8261% abortion > 3.687% nutrition > 2.603% illness > climate change 2.341% > 1.338% accident > 1.115% housing > 0.969% care of pregnant > 0.819% management > 0.800% milk > 0.697% dystocia, respectively. Conclusion: The mortality rates of lambs were found very high with abortion, nutrition, illness, and climate change. Hence, due to the impact level of main risk factors on mortality rate, efforts should be made to increase lambing supervision, improve management of newborn lambs, and prevent diseases by focusing on the good feeding of animals

    Dispelling the Myths Behind First-author Citation Counts

    Get PDF
    We conducted a full-scale evaluative citation analysis study of scholars in the XML research field to explore just how different from each other author rankings resulting from different citation counting methods actually are, and to demonstrate the capability of emerging data and tools on the Web in supporting more realistic citation counting methods. Our results contest some common arguments for the continued use of first-author citation counts in the evaluation of scholars, such as high correlations between author rankings by first-author citation counts and other citation counting methods, and high costs of using more realistic citation counting methods that are not well-supported by the ISI databases. It is argued that increasingly available digital full text research papers make it possible for citation analysis studies to go beyond what the ISI databases have directly supported and to employ more sophisticated methods
